>>56981271
I think you probably don't fully realise how small it's going to be in terms of height. Smaller than a 17" 4:3.

Pic related is how it compares to a 27" 16:9, which you could get for the same price and is what I would personally consider the minimum for a new desktop monitor. As you can see, the 27" is also wider, meaning you could get the same size display as the 21:9@25" on a 16:9@27" just by masking the rest off in software.

I hesitate to call anyone an idiot for buying something they want, but since you'd be paying the same money for less size in both dimensions, I would urge you to reconsider.

>>56982105
He meant pillarbox but it's the same idea. Content that can't take advantage of widescreen- many games, most non-movie video- would stay within a tiny 16:9 area in the middle, with the rest being dead space filled with black ("black bars").
